Intrinsic hydroquinone-functionalized aggregation-induced emission core shows redox and pH sensitivity
Aggregation-induced emission (AIE) is exploited for several optoelectronic applications, but synthesizing molecules that respond to multiple stimuli is challenging. Here, the authors report a hydroquinone bearing an AIE-active core that responds to both redox and pH changes.
